recfSlotModuleStartMode OBJECT-TYPE SYNTAX INTEGER { automatic(1), off(2), erase(3) } ACCESS read-write STATUS mandatory DESCRIPTION "Parameter Type = Intrusive. Setting to erase will fail if any of the following conditions are true: (1) The module's redundant mode is set to one-to-one redundancy. (2) The module has any unremoved INLs. (3) The module has any channels that are not disconnected. (4) There is hardware present in the slot, and the module is in an active or standby state, or is going into an active or standby state (i.e., is initializing or loading). Otherwise, the erase command will erase the module configuration and all of the ports, bundles, INLs, and channels on the module." DEFVAL { off } ::= { recfSlotEntry 2 }
